Steps

Step 1

Layer your blender from soft to hard (bottom to top!) and blend it all together. I continue to add small amounts of liquid if I need to, to help it blend together smoothly while keeping it thick and creamy! To thin it out, add more liquid. To thicken it, add more ice, frozen zucchini, and/or cauliflower rice!

Step 2

Time for toppings! One topping is a melted dark chocolate drizzle. Here are the deets:

INGREDIENTS

  • 1/4 cup dark chocolate chips

  • 1-2 teaspoon coconut oil

Mix and melt these two ingredients together. Drizzle over your smoothie!

Step 3

The second topping is an easy paleo “caramel” sauce! Here are the deets:

INGREDIENTS

  • 1/4 cup coconut oil

  • 1/4 cup pure maple syrup (or monkfruit syrup!)

  • 2 tablespoons almond butter

  • Dash of vanilla extract

  • Pinch of sea salt

  • Sprinkle of cinnamon

Melt the coconut oil and maple syrup in a glass jar for about 60 seconds. Whisk in almond butter, vanilla, sea salt, and cinnamon until very smooth. Add it on top and store in the fridge!
